A clear route into the JUYONDAI style
Red is made with Yamada Nishiki and Aiyama from Yokawa’s Special-A district in Hyogo. It presents the fruit-rich, umami-led style associated with JUYONDAI in an open, balanced expression.
How it tastes

Yubari melon, ripe La France pear, red apple, young banana and orange blossom lead into a silk-smooth mouthfeel. Juicy acidity balances the rice umami, while a gentle mandarin-peel bitterness gives the finish a dry definition.
The juicy acidity stays bright against the rice umami, while the mandarin-peel bitterness sharpens the dry finish.
Murayama, Yamagata — more than four centuries of craft
Founded in Murayama, Yamagata in 1615, Takagi Sake Brewery brings more than four centuries of craft and sensibility to every expression of JUYONDAI.
